chainlib-eth

Ethereum implementation of the chainlib interface
Log | Files | Refs | README | LICENSE

commit 3c55bc9ac21555318538f75901478d1648540585
parent 65b10ea3068ff8afb78284b55305d9ef05386f0a
Author: lash <dev@holbrook.no>
Date:   Thu, 12 May 2022 16:13:02 +0000

Implement 'raw' cli tool on settings module

Diffstat:
Mchainlib/eth/runnable/wait.py | 11+++--------
1 file changed, 3 insertions(+), 8 deletions(-)

diff --git a/chainlib/eth/runnable/wait.py b/chainlib/eth/runnable/wait.py @@ -83,14 +83,9 @@ config = process_config(config, arg, args, flags) config = process_config_local(config, arg, args, flags) logg.debug('config loaded:\n{}'.format(config)) -rpc = chainlib.eth.cli.Rpc() -conn = rpc.connect_by_config(config) - -chain_spec = None -try: - chain_spec = ChainSpec.from_chain_str(config.get('CHAIN_SPEC')) -except AttributeError: - pass +settings = ChainSettings() +settings = process_settings(settings, config) +logg.debug('settings loaded:\n{}'.format(settings)) def main():